A group of newcomers got down and dirty recently at Knotty Threads. The activity was organized by Brenda Colbourne with Bev Lambeth, Daphne Field and me completing the foursome. We joined Ryan (the owner) to learn the technique involved in creating felted scarves.
Starting with nothing but the desire to make one, we chose the colours of wool, designed the patterns and then poured watering cans full of water over our creations. Under Ryan’s watchful eye, we soaked, squeezed, rolled and banged the scarves until each was dry enough to spread out and straighten. Two hours from the start, the scarves were ready for inspection–all sorts of colours and all types of designs–and then on their way home with four new and happy felters![/wa_restricted]
